摘要
The traditional fault tree analysis is very difficult to solve the reliability problem of multi-state system with various failure modes. In this paper, a reliability analysis method for multi-state systems based on Bayesian network is proposed. The general steps of building a Bayesian network of multi-state systems are provided, and the calculation method of the consequence probability and the importance degree of RRW, RAW and FV are also given in this paper. The proposed Bayesian network model can be used to describe the multi-state system well, and it can take full advantage of historical information for system fault diagnosis and prediction. Finally, an application example is illustrated to verify the effectiveness and feasibility of the proposed method.
